My unit has a Wayne burner on it and it has no problem staying hot. I’ve ran it as high as 210 in winter just to see and it didn’t struggle one bit.

I asked a guy at Landa about them today and he said they have worked with them since the 80’s and the only time they ever had issues is when they tried to go away from them and use their own surefire burners so they went back to them.

1 Like

If you have 100,000 btu’s per one gallon per minute you should be more than fine.
